Met Office issues weather warning for North West

Date published: 04 August 2013


Heavy rain this evening will continue overnight and into Monday before easing. Accumulations of 20-40mm are likely in many parts. The public are advised to be aware of the risk of surface water flooding.

Despite the heavy rain, forecasters are predicting the rest of August will see a return of the sunshine.

By Tuesday the rain will start to clear, leaving cloud and sunny spells into Wednesday.
